Old Lake<br />

Wilson Road<br />

Widening<br />

Engineer: HWA.<br />

CMAR: WG Mills, Inc. / Ranger Building<br />

Services, Inc., a Joint Venture.<br />

Utility Subcontractor: Wright’s Excavating<br />

This project consists of utility relocations<br />

along Old Lake Wilson Road between<br />

Westgate Boulevard and Sinclair Road in<br />

conjunction with the County’s road widening<br />

project. This project also includes a 12” and<br />

16” reuse main along Old Lake Wilson Road<br />

between Livingston Road and Sinclair Road<br />

and a reuse connection at Livingston Road<br />

and Sand Hill Road. The reuse<br />

improvements will provide 0.2 MGD of reuse<br />

to existing developments along the<br />

Livingston and Old Lake Wilson Road<br />

corridors. Reuse demand within the<br />

corridors will increase to approximately 1.2<br />

MGD as the area is further developed.<br />

The utility improvements include: 2,700 LF of<br />

30” water main (WM), 2,600 LF of 24” WM,<br />

800 LF of 16” 12” and 8” WM, 1,200 LF of<br />

16” reuse main (RM), 12,500 LF of 12” RM,<br />

4,300 LF of 30” force main (FM), 2,400 LF of<br />

8” FM, and 700 LF of 12” 10” and 6” FM.<br />

The utility portion of the<br />

project is substantially<br />

complete, pending submittal<br />

of the Substantial Completion<br />

form by the CMAR and<br />

FDEP water main clearance.<br />

The utility contractor is<br />

currently completing punchlist<br />

items generated on the<br />

substantial completion<br />

walkthrough.<br />

Final wastewater permit<br />

clearance has been received.<br />

Final water permit clearance<br />

application has been<br />

submitted to FDEP.<br />
